Bedside Table Height Guide — Match Your Bed
The top of your bedside table should sit level with the top of your mattress, or up to 5 cm above or below it. This puts your lamp, phone and water glass at a comfortable arm's-reach height when you're lying in bed. Here's a quick-reference table based on standard Australian bed frames:
| Bed Frame Type | Typical Mattress-Top Height | Ideal Bedside Table Height |
|---|---|---|
| Low platform bed / floor bed | 35–45 cm | 35–50 cm |
| Standard slatted bed frame | 50–60 cm | 50–65 cm |
| Upholstered bed frame (PU leather / fabric) | 55–65 cm | 55–70 cm |
| Ensemble base (mattress on base) | 60–70 cm | 60–75 cm |
| Gas-lift storage bed | 55–65 cm | 55–70 cm |
How to measure: Place a tape measure on the floor beside your bed and measure to the top surface of your mattress (not the bed frame or headboard). Use that number to choose a bedside table within 5 cm above or below.
Bedside Table Width Guide — What Fits Your Space?
Bedside tables come in a range of widths. The right choice depends on your bed size, the available gap between the bed and the wall, and how much surface area you need.
| Width Range | Best For | Surface Holds |
|---|---|---|
| 30–40 cm (slim/compact) | Single beds, king singles, tight spaces, kids' rooms | Lamp + phone, or a small clock |
| 40–50 cm (standard) | Double and queen beds — the most popular size in Australian bedrooms | Lamp + phone + book + water glass |
| 50–60 cm+ (wide/generous) | King and super king beds, large master bedrooms | Lamp + tray with decor + books + phone + water |
Spacing tip: Allow at least 5–10 cm between the edge of your bed and the bedside table so you can tuck sheets in easily and the table doesn't feel cramped against the mattress.
How to Choose the Right Black Bedside Table — Expert Tips
After 12+ years helping Queensland households furnish their bedrooms, here's what our team recommends:
- Match the height to your mattress top. Use the height guide above. A table that's too low forces awkward reaching; too high and your lamp glares into your eyes. Getting this right makes a noticeable comfort difference.
- Measure the gap beside your bed. Before you buy, measure the space between the side of your bed and the nearest wall or obstacle. Subtract 5–10 cm for clearance. That's your maximum table width.
- Decide on drawers vs. open shelves. Drawers hide clutter and keep the surface clean — ideal if you're particular about a tidy bedroom. Open shelves provide easy grab-and-go access and display space for books or baskets. Some models offer both.
- Buy in pairs for symmetry — or don't. A matching pair of black bedside tables creates a classic, hotel-style balanced look. But mixing styles (for example, a drawer unit on one side and a slimmer open-shelf table on the other) works well when partners have different storage needs, or when one side of the bed has less space.
- Coordinate with your bed frame. A black bedside table paired with a black bed frame creates a cohesive, tonal look. For contrast, pair black tables with a white or natural timber bed frame. Both approaches work — it's a matter of personal style.
- Consider Queensland's humidity. In Brisbane and Gold Coast's subtropical climate, timber furniture needs good airflow to prevent moisture build-up. Pull bedside tables 5 cm away from exterior walls, and air-condition or dehumidify in the wettest months. Painted and sealed finishes resist humidity better than raw or lightly oiled timber.

Styling Your Black Bedside Tables
A well-styled bedside table makes the whole bedroom feel more considered and put-together. Here's a simple formula that interior stylists use:
- Start with a lamp. A table lamp or wall-mounted sconce provides warm, functional reading light. Choose a shade that's roughly one-third the height of the lamp base for visual balance. A lighter shade (white, cream, linen) softens the contrast against the black table surface.
- Add one vertical element. A small vase with stems, a framed photo, or a stack of 2–3 books gives height and draws the eye upward.
- Finish with one small accent. A candle, a decorative tray, or a small potted plant completes the arrangement without cluttering the surface.
- Keep it to 3–5 items. Overloading the surface defeats the purpose of a tidy bedside. If you have more items to store, use the drawers or a shelf underneath.
Colour pairing ideas: Black tables look stunning with brass or gold hardware (lamp base, picture frame, tray). White and cream decor creates crisp contrast. Warm timber accents (photo frame, coaster) add a natural, relaxed feel. Greenery (a small potted plant or eucalyptus sprig) brings life and freshness to the dark surface.

Caring for Black Bedside Tables in Queensland's Climate
Painted & lacquered timber: Dust weekly with a soft, dry cloth. For marks, use a damp cloth with mild soap and dry immediately — never leave water sitting on the surface. Place coasters under drinks and felt pads under decor to prevent scratches.
Stained timber: Apply furniture wax or oil annually to maintain the finish. In Brisbane and Gold Coast's humid summers, ensure airflow around the table — pull it 5 cm away from exterior walls. Run a dehumidifier or air-conditioner during the wettest months to prevent moisture damage.
Metal frames: Wipe with a dry or slightly damp cloth. Never use abrasive pads on powder-coated finishes.
Glass tops: Clean with glass cleaner and a lint-free cloth. Avoid placing heavy objects on unsupported glass edges.

Frequently Asked Questions — Black Bedside Tables
What height should a bedside table be?
The top of your bedside table should sit level with the top of your mattress, give or take 5 cm. For standard Australian bed frames with a mattress, that's typically 50–65 cm. For ensemble bases, aim for 60–75 cm. Use our height guide table above to find the right match for your bed type.
Do I need matching bedside tables on both sides?
Not necessarily. A matching pair creates a classic, symmetrical, hotel-style look. But mixing styles or sizes works well when partners have different storage needs, or when one side of the bed has less space than the other. Both approaches are common in modern Australian bedrooms.
Do black bedside tables show dust easily?
Black surfaces can show light-coloured dust more readily than lighter furniture, but a quick wipe with a soft dry cloth once a week keeps them looking pristine. Overall, black hides fingerprints, water rings and minor scuffs much better than white finishes.
How wide should a bedside table be?
For single and king single beds, a slim 30–40 cm table is ideal. For double and queen beds, the standard 40–50 cm width suits most rooms. For king and super king beds, go wider at 50–60 cm+ for proportion. Always measure the gap between your bed and the wall first, then subtract 5–10 cm for clearance.
What colours go with a black bedside table?
Black is one of the most versatile furniture colours. White and cream bedding or walls creates classic high contrast. Warm timber accents add natural balance. Brass or gold hardware (lamp base, picture frame) adds sophistication. Greenery and soft textures (linen, velvet) keep the look warm rather than stark.
